With the announcement that Prince Andrew has given up his titles, Sarah, Duchess of York, has also lost hers.
Since her divorce from the Prince in 1996, she has been known as “Sarah, Duchess of York.” However, now that Prince Andrew has relinquished his titles, Sarah has also lost hers.
She will now be known as her maiden name, Sarah Ferguson.
Sarah, who is commonly called by her nickname Fergie, still resides with Andrew at the Royal Lodge as the pair remained close after their divorce.
Andrew will retain the princely title he has had since birth.
Princesses Beatrice and Eugenie will also remain princesses as they are grandchildren of a sovereign born in the male line.
